Under Dr. Lester's leadership, the Coastal Commission fought private
interests to guarantee free, public access to hundreds of miles of
pristine and urban coastline ... protected coastal communities from
climate change by ensuring sea level rise is taken into account in local
coastal planning ... and championed a Local Coastal Program for the Santa
Monica Mountains that protects open space.
